The seven-second delay for live television was introduced in 1975 by NBC so that Richard Pryor could host Saturday Night Live without the network getting fined for all of his obscenities. The delay would also be useful. we discovered if a man were to be shot point blank in the head, live on national television. This is 911 dispatch.
